### Understanding Hair Growth and Common Hair Disorders


Before diving into the recipes, it’s essential to understand the basics of hair growth and the common disorders that can impede this process. Hair growth occurs in cycles: the anagen phase (growth phase), catagen phase (transitional phase), and telogen phase (resting phase). The anagen phase can last anywhere from two to seven years, determining how long your hair can grow.

**Hair Disorders That Affect Growth**:


1. **Alopecia Areata**: 

This autoimmune disorder causes hair to fall out in small patches, leading to noticeable hair loss.

2. **Telogen Effluvium**: 

Often triggered by stress, this condition pushes hair into the resting phase prematurely, leading to shedding.

3. **Androgenic Alopecia**: 

Also known as male or female pattern baldness, this genetic condition leads to thinning and hair loss over time.

Understanding these disorders can help in choosing the right DIY hair elixir to address specific needs.

### DIY Hair Elixirs to Boost Growth


#### 1. **Castor Oil and Peppermint Elixir**


**Why It Works**: 

Castor oil is rich in ricinoleic acid, a fatty acid that helps lock in moisture and improve blood circulation to the scalp. Peppermint oil stimulates hair follicles, encouraging the growth phase of hair.

**Ingredients**:

- 2 tablespoons of castor oil
- 5 drops of peppermint essential oil
- 1 tablespoon of coconut oil (optional)

**Instructions**:

1. Warm the castor oil slightly to make it easier to apply.
2. Add the peppermint essential oil and mix well.
3. If you have thick hair, add coconut oil to make the elixir more spreadable.
4. Massage the mixture into your scalp for 5-10 minutes to stimulate circulation.
5. Leave it on for at least 2 hours or overnight before washing it out with a mild shampoo.

**Usage**: 

Use this elixir twice a week for the best results. It’s especially beneficial for those with thinning hair or slow hair growth.

#### 2. **Rosemary and Olive Oil Elixir**


**Why It Works**: 

Rosemary oil is known for its ability to improve cellular generation, making it an excellent choice for boosting hair growth. Olive oil, rich in antioxidants, nourishes the scalp and strengthens hair strands.

**Ingredients**:

- 3 tablespoons of extra virgin olive oil
- 10 drops of rosemary essential oil
- 1 teaspoon of honey (optional for added moisture)

**Instructions**:

1. Combine the olive oil and rosemary essential oil in a small bowl.
2. Add honey if your hair is dry or damaged.
3. Heat the mixture slightly to enhance absorption.
4. Apply the elixir to your scalp and hair, focusing on the roots.
5. Wrap your hair in a warm towel and leave it on for 1-2 hours.
6. Rinse thoroughly with lukewarm water and shampoo as usual.

**Usage**: 

This elixir can be used once a week to stimulate hair growth and add shine.

#### 3. **Aloe Vera and Onion Juice Elixir**


**Why It Works**: 

Aloe vera is a powerful ingredient for soothing the scalp and reducing dandruff, a common cause of hair thinning. Onion juice, rich in sulfur, boosts collagen production, which in turn promotes hair growth.

**Ingredients**:

- 2 tablespoons of fresh aloe vera gel
- 1 tablespoon of onion juice
- 1 teaspoon of almond oil

**Instructions**:

1. Extract fresh aloe vera gel from the leaf and blend it until smooth.
2. Mix in the onion juice and almond oil.
3. Apply the elixir to your scalp, focusing on areas where hair is thinning.
4. Leave it on for 30-45 minutes before rinsing it out with a mild shampoo.

**Usage**: 

Use this elixir once a week to promote healthy hair growth and reduce hair fall.

#### 4. **Coconut Milk and Fenugreek Elixir**


**Why It Works**: 

Coconut milk is packed with vitamins and fatty acids that nourish the hair and scalp. Fenugreek seeds are rich in proteins and nicotinic acid, which are effective in treating hair loss and dandruff.

**Ingredients**:

- 1/2 cup of coconut milk
- 2 tablespoons of fenugreek seeds
- 1 tablespoon of olive oil

**Instructions**:

1. Soak the fenugreek seeds in water overnight.
2. Grind the soaked seeds into a fine paste.
3. Mix the paste with coconut milk and olive oil.
4. Apply the elixir to your scalp and hair, ensuring even coverage.
5. Leave it on for 1-2 hours before washing it out with lukewarm water and a gentle shampoo.

**Usage**: 

Apply this elixir once a week for stronger, thicker hair.

#### 5. **Green Tea and Jojoba Oil Elixir**


**Why It Works**: 

Green tea contains antioxidants that promote hair growth by inhibiting DHT (dihydrotestosterone), a hormone linked to hair loss. Jojoba oil moisturizes the scalp and unclogs hair follicles, which can improve hair growth.

**Ingredients**:

- 1/2 cup of brewed green tea (cooled)
- 2 tablespoons of jojoba oil
- 5 drops of tea tree oil (optional for dandruff-prone scalp)

**Instructions**:

1. Brew a cup of green tea and let it cool to room temperature.
2. Mix the cooled tea with jojoba oil and tea tree oil.
3. Apply the elixir to your scalp and hair, massaging gently to stimulate the follicles.
4. Leave it on for 30-60 minutes before rinsing with lukewarm water.

**Usage**: 

Use this elixir twice a week to boost growth and maintain a healthy scalp.
